What is dividend investing?

Dividend investing is a proven strategy that is focused on solely investing in dividend growth stocks that pay a dividend. Usually a company has two options use their cash flow from operations: one is paying a dividend to shareholders and the other is reinvesting the cash flow into the business. A dividend is a payment made by a company to reward shareholders. We’ve built the ultimate guide to building a dividend portfolio to help you succeed in your path to financial freedom.

Why is dividend investing life changing?

If you turn your focus to building a dividend portfolio, you enable yourself to live free. Building a dividend portfolio takes time and effort. However, if you have a specialized plan, you can build your wealth rapidly. Warren Buffett invested in Coca-Cola over 25 years ago. The stock and dividend has increased so much in value that Warren Buffett receives over a 40% dividend yield from his initial investment! I doubt Warren Buffett will ever sell a share of Coca-Cola.

If you look at Warren Buffet’s portfolio, nearly all stocks pay a dividend.

Where do you start to build a dividend portfolio?

• Find a brokerage that you like and one that offers low-commission trading. There are a number of different sites out there that will allow you to trade completely commission-free.

• Write down on paper how much you plan to allocate to the portfolio each month. Try to exceed that amount each month and increase it each year.

• Find the best undervalued dividend growth stocks to start building your portfolio. I suggest having at least 3-4 Dividend Kings in your portfolio. Dividend Kings are safe, high-quality dividend growth stocks that have at least 50 years of increasing their dividends.

• Make your initial investment in the companies that you understand. 

• When you receive your first dividend payment, reinvest it back into your portfolio of stocks! Make sure you are fully invested at all times and continue to allocate your balance transfers.

• Sit back and enjoy the show. Follow the plan and before you know it, your income will continue increase over time.

Please note that you should make these considerations after you have funded your retirement accounts in full or as much as possible. I always advocate for tax-advantaged accounts like a 401(k), Roth IRA or IRA should be fully invested first. After that, you can allocate the remaining to the dividend portfolio as a “sidecar” to build your income.
